Single A- Defending Champ Humboldt returns entire starting line-up so will again be a force. Lake County loses both post players Devon Jones and Justin Kimble but return Zay Coleman and watch out for upcoming Sophomores Darius Johnson and Stavonski Wilkes to step in and play well next year so I would not count them out just yet, 2 title game appearances in the last 3 years. Union City will return almost everything as well as South Fulton so 14-A will be a meat grinder once again. Also I see the usual suspects from the other region BTW, TCA,Middleton and now add Mitchell to the mix as well. All very talented teams capable of winning it all. Which teams make it from the west is anybody's guess, could honestly be any of the above mentioned teams, but I feel whoever does has a very good chance at winning it all!!
